CALL FOR ARTISTS TO 42nd ANNUAL
CAIN PARK ARTS FESTIVAL
Artists are invited to apply to the juried Cain Park Arts Festival
F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E
(CLEVELAND HEIGHTS, OH) – For the first time in its 42-year history, artist applications are being accepted through Zapplication.org to the 2019 Cain Park Arts Festival. Application deadine is March 1, 2019.
The Cain Park Arts Festival is a juried fine arts and crafts event that was named to Sunshine Artist 200 Best Shows for a second consecutive year in 2018. The Arts Festival features the work of artists from across the country with a wide range of fine art categories including painting, photography, prints, jewelry, ceramics, glass, leather, sculpture, wood, and other materials.

This all ages and family friendly arts festival is open Friday, July 12 (3-8pm) Saturday, July 13 (10am-8pm), Sunday, July 14 (12-5pm). Admission is free on Friday and $5 per person on Saturday and Sunday (children 12 and under are free). 


Cain Park, a municipally owned and operated summer performing arts park and one of the nation’s oldest landmark outdoors celebrating its 81st season in 2019, is produced by the City of Cleveland Heights and is located on Superior Road between Lee and South Taylor roads.
